Aloha Chicken Wings
- 3 lbs chicken wings
- 1 cup pineapple preserves
- 1/2 cup dry sherry
- 1/2 cup frozen orange juice concentrate
- 1/2 cup soy sauce
- 1/2 cup brown sugar, packed
- 1/4 cup vegetable oil
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on ground ginger
- Cut wings into sections and discard tips or save for another use.
- Place wings in a large resealable plastic ziplock bag.
- Stir together preserves, sherry, orange juice concentrate, soy sauce, brown sugar, oil, garlic, and ginger, until thoroughly combined.
- Pour mixture over wings in bag and seal.
- Work marinade over all parts of chicken wings and allow wings to marinate, refrigerated, for 6 hours or overnight.
- Place wings on a foil-covered baking pan and pour 1 cup of the marinade over the wings; discard the rest of the marinade.
- Bake wings at 350F for 1 hour.
